HttpServerUtilityBase.Execute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our une ressource spécifiée dans le contexte de la requête actuelle et retourne l’exécution au processus qui l’a appelée.
Surcharges
| Nom | Description |
|---|---|
| Execute(String) |
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el. |
| Execute(String, Boolean) |
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el et spécifie s’il faut effacer les collections et QueryString les Form supprimer. |
| Execute(String, TextWriter) |
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té. |
| Execute(String, TextWriter, Boolean) |
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in d’accès virtuel spécifié dans le contexte de la requête actuelle, à l’aide d’une TextWriter instance pour capturer la sortie de la page et une valeur qui indique s’il faut effacer les collections et QueryString les Form collections. |
| Execute(IHttpHandler, TextWriter, Boolean) |
En cas de substitution dans une classe dérivée, exécute le gestionnaire sp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té et une valeur qui spécifie s’il faut effacer les collections et QueryString les Form collections. |
Execute(String)
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el.
public:
virtual void Execute(System::String ^ path);
public virtual void Execute(string path);
abstract member Execute : string -> unit
override this.Execute : string -> unit
Public Overridable Sub Execute (path As String)
Paramètres
- path
- String
URL du gestionnaire à exécuter.
Exceptions
Toujours.
S’applique à
Execute(String, Boolean)
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el et spécifie s’il faut effacer les collections et QueryString les Form supprimer.
public:
virtual void Execute(System::String ^ path, bool preserveForm);
public virtual void Execute(string path, bool preserveForm);
abstract member Execute : string * bool -> unit
override this.Execute : string * bool -> unit
Public Overridable Sub Execute (path As String, preserveForm As Boolean)
Paramètres
- path
- String
URL du gestionnaire à exécuter.
- preserveForm
- Boolean
truepour conserver les QueryString collections ; Formfalse pour effacer les collections et QueryString les Form collections.
Exceptions
Toujours.
S’applique à
Execute(String, TextWriter)
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té.
public:
virtual void Execute(System::String ^ path, System::IO::TextWriter ^ writer);
public virtual void Execute(string path, System.IO.TextWriter writer);
abstract member Execute : string * System.IO.TextWriter -> unit
override this.Execute : string * System.IO.TextWriter -> unit
Public Overridable Sub Execute (path As String, writer As TextWriter)
Paramètres
- path
- String
URL du gestionnaire à exécuter.
- writer
- TextWriter
Objet pour capturer la sortie.
Exceptions
Toujours.
Remarques
Le writer paramètre est passé par référence à la Execute méthode. Pour récupérer la sortie du gestionnaire une fois la méthode terminée, vous utilisez les propriétés et méthodes de l’objet writer . Pour obtenir un exemple, consultez Execute.
S’applique à
Execute(String, TextWriter, Boolean)
En cas de substitution dans une classe dérivée, exécute le gestionnaire pour le chemin d’accès virtuel spécifié dans le contexte de la requête actuelle, à l’aide d’une TextWriter instance pour capturer la sortie de la page et une valeur qui indique s’il faut effacer les collections et QueryString les Form collections.
public:
virtual void Execute(System::String ^ path, System::IO::TextWriter ^ writer, bool preserveForm);
public virtual void Execute(string path, System.IO.TextWriter writer, bool preserveForm);
abstract member Execute : string * System.IO.TextWriter * bool -> unit
override this.Execute : string * System.IO.TextWriter * bool -> unit
Public Overridable Sub Execute (path As String, writer As TextWriter, preserveForm As Boolean)
Paramètres
- path
- String
URL du gestionnaire à exécuter.
- writer
- TextWriter
Objet à capturer la sortie.
- preserveForm
- Boolean
truepour conserver les QueryString collections ; Formfalse pour effacer les collections et QueryString les Form collections.
Exceptions
Toujours.
Remarques
Le writer paramètre est passé par référence à la Execute méthode. Pour récupérer la sortie du gestionnaire une fois la méthode terminée, vous utilisez les propriétés et méthodes de l’objet writer . Pour obtenir un exemple, consultez Execute.
S’applique à
Execute(IHttpHandler, TextWriter, Boolean)
En cas de substitution dans une classe dérivée, exécute le gestionnaire sp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té et une valeur qui spécifie s’il faut effacer les collections et QueryString les Form collections.
public:
virtual void Execute(System::Web::IHttpHandler ^ handler, System::IO::TextWriter ^ writer, bool preserveForm);
public virtual void Execute(System.Web.IHttpHandler handler, System.IO.TextWriter writer, bool preserveForm);
abstract member Execute : System.Web.IHttpHandler * System.IO.TextWriter * bool -> unit
override this.Execute : System.Web.IHttpHandler * System.IO.TextWriter * bool -> unit
Public Overridable Sub Execute (handler As IHttpHandler, writer As TextWriter, preserveForm As Boolean)
Paramètres
- handler
- IHttpHandler
Gestionnaire HTTP vers lequel implémente l’interface pour transférer la requête actuelle.
- writer
- TextWriter
Objet à capturer la sortie.
- preserveForm
- Boolean
truepour conserver les QueryString collections ; Formfalse pour effacer les collections et QueryString les Form collections.
Exceptions
Toujours.
Remarques
Le writer paramètre est passé par référence à la Execute méthode. Pour récupérer la sortie du gestionnaire une fois la méthode terminée, vous utilisez les propriétés et méthodes de l’objet writer . Pour obtenir un exemple, consultez Execute.